Year: 1985
Runtime: 171 mins
Language: Hindi
Director: J. P. Dutta
Set in the border town of Fatehpur on the India‑Pakistan frontier, the story follows Ranjit Singh Choudhary, a young man branded a rebel by his schoolmaster and by his father’s employer, Bade Thakur. Unwilling to accept the exploitation of his father’s generation, who have become economic slaves to the upper‑caste Thakurs that lend them money, Ranjit confronts the systemic injustice and fights for his fellow farmers.

In the dusty border town of Fatehpur, where the red earth of Rajasthan meets the uneasy line between India and Pakistan, daily life is governed by a rigid caste hierarchy and the weight of generations‑old land agreements. The villagers toil under the shadow of a powerful zamindar family, their futures bound to loans and loyalties that stretch back decades. Against this backdrop, the air carries a quiet tension—a mixture of sun‑baked heat and the muted murmur of a community yearning for change.
Ranjit Singh Choudhary arrives from a modest farming background, his spirit already marked by rebellion. Branded a troublemaker by his schoolmaster and dismissed by Bade Thakur, the wealthy landlord whose debts the peasants carry like invisible shackles, Ranjit feels the sting of a system that rewards birth over labor. His youthful defiance is tempered by a keen awareness of the injustices that coil around his family and neighbors, and a determination to confront the exploitation that has long kept his community in servitude.
The film’s tone is unflinching yet human, marrying stark social critique with intimate moments of hope. Through Ranjit’s eyes, the audience glimpses the fragile bonds between villagers—friendships forged in hardship, quietly supportive figures who share his longing for dignity. A narrator’s calm, resonant voice guides the story, lending an authoritative cadence that underscores the stakes without ever romanticising the struggle.
As the narrative unfolds, the border town becomes a character in its own right, its bustling markets, schoolrooms, and fields reflecting both the oppressive structures and the simmering desire for a different future. Within this world, Ranjit stands at the crossroads of tradition and revolt, embodying the fierce resolve of a generation ready to question the inherited order.
